Stalled projects get worse on their own. The first move is factual, not adversarial.
Recovery starts with an independent assessment of work in place, remaining scope, and cost to complete, followed by a contract review to establish remedies and obligations, then a re-planned delivery approach — with the existing contractor or a replacement.
Cost to complete is priced against a re-scoped set of documents, not the original contract sum. Replacement contractors price risk into unfinished work they did not start — expect that, budget for it, and select on capability rather than the lowest number a second time.
